A collision between two buses in Syria has left at least 35 people dead and 30 others injured, Reuters and AP reported on the 25th (local time), citing Syrian state-run SANA news agency.
The accident occurred when a Ministry of Interior bus transporting security forces collided with a civilian passenger bus on a desert highway connecting Deir ez-Zor and Damascus.
The exact cause of the accident has not yet been determined.
The Syrian Ministry of Defense announced that it has dispatched helicopters to the accident scene to transport the injured to hospitals.
